Supplementary Information:
This supplementary information is collated from multiple sources and compiled automatically.
FLAP also known as ALOX5AP is an important protein in the leukotriene biosynthetic pathway. It functions mechanically as a membrane-associated protein that facilitates the transfer of arachidonic acid to 5-lipoxygenase (5-LOX) a critical step in the production of leukotrienes. FLAP has a molecular mass of approximately 18 kDa and is primarily expressed in cells of the myeloid lineage such as neutrophils monocytes and macrophages.
Biological function summary
FLAP plays an essential role in the inflammatory response and is a component of the leukotriene synthesis complex. This complex is responsible for the production of leukotrienes which are potent lipid mediators that contribute to inflammation and immune regulation. By regulating leukotriene synthesis FLAP supports processes like chemotaxis cell aggregation and smooth muscle contraction essential for the body's response to inflammation.
Pathways
The FLAP signaling pathway is integral to the leukotriene metabolic pathway. It facilitates the interaction between arachidonic acid and 5-LOX leading to the generation of leukotrienes such as LTA4 and LTB4. These molecules are involved in numerous processes including bronchoconstriction and migration of leukocytes. Proteins related to FLAP within this pathway include 5-LOX and LTC4 synthase which further convert leukotrienes into biologically active compounds.
FLAP is associated with asthma and cardiovascular diseases. Its role in producing leukotrienes links it to the pathogenesis of inflammatory conditions. Elevated levels of leukotrienes mediated by FLAP can exacerbate symptoms in asthma by causing bronchial constriction. In cardiovascular diseases FLAP-related pathway dysregulation can contribute to atherosclerosis development.
